The Vice President, Quality Assurance & Regulatory Affairs is a member of the Executive Leadership Team responsible for the strategic direction, leadership, and execution of all Quality Assurance, Regulatory Affairs, Compliance, and Quality Systems activities for Nihon Kohden America. Serving as the Company's Management Representative, this position ensures the effectiveness and continuous improvement of the Quality Management System (QMS) while supporting the Company's sales, marketing, service, clinical support, and product lifecycle management activities. The Vice President serves as the primary liaison with regulatory authorities and certification bodies and partners closely with Nihon Kohden Corporation (NKC) to identify and implement the most efficient, compliant, and customer-focused approaches to regulatory, quality, and post-market activities. Essential Functions and Main Duties Establishes and executes Quality Assurance and Regulatory Affairs strategies that support business growth, customer satisfaction, product lifecycle management, and operational excellence. Serves as a member of the Executive Leadership Team, providing strategic counsel regarding quality, regulatory, compliance, and business risk matters. Promotes a culture of quality, compliance, accountability, continuous improvement, and customer focus throughout the organization. Quality Management System Leadership Serves as the Company's Management Representative and maintains an effective, compliant, and scalable Quality Management System (QMS) in accordance with FDA, ISO 13485, Health Canada, and company requirements. Provides executive oversight for CAPA, complaint handling, document control, training, change control, supplier quality, risk management, and management review processes. Leads continuous improvement initiatives and establishes quality objectives, metrics, and performance indicators to strengthen organizational performance. Regulatory Affairs Develops and executes regulatory strategies supporting product registrations, market access, product modifications, software releases, and lifecycle management activities within the United States and Canada. Oversees preparation, review, and submission of FDA 510(k) applications, Health Canada licensing activities, and other required regulatory filings. Ensures compliance of product labeling, promotional materials, customer communications, and regulatory documentation while monitoring evolving regulatory requirements. Partnership with Nihon Kohden Corporation (NKC) Serves as the primary quality and regulatory liaison between NKA and NKC. Collaborates with NKC Quality, Regulatory, Clinical, Engineering, and Product Development teams to execute regulatory and quality initiatives efficiently and compliantly. Drives alignment on product changes, software releases, complaint investigations, submissions, field actions, and lifecycle management strategies to support business objectives. Audit, Inspection, and Compliance Management Serves as the primary company representative for FDA inspections, Health Canada assessments, and BSI ISO 13485 surveillance and recertification audits. Maintains inspection and audit readiness while ensuring successful execution and follow-through of all regulatory and certification activities. Directs responses to audit findings, regulatory observations, nonconformities, and compliance commitments, including verification of corrective actions. Complaint Handling and Post-Market Activities Provides executive oversight of complaint handling, adverse event reporting, post-market surveillance, recalls, corrections, removals, and field actions. Leads investigation, root cause analysis, and corrective and preventive action activities associated with quality and compliance issues. Analyzes quality and customer feedback trends to improve product performance, customer satisfaction, and organizational effectiveness. Product Quality and Commercial Support Provides quality and regulatory leadership supporting Sales, Marketing, Service, Clinical, and Product Management activities. Supports commercialization efforts, product launches, software updates, and product lifecycle management while ensuring ongoing compliance. Drives customer-focused quality initiatives that improve product performance and the overall customer experience. Qualifications Education / Certification / Experience Required Bachelor's degree in Engineering, Life Sciences, Biomedical Sciences, Quality, Regulatory Affairs, or a related technical discipline. Equivalent combination of education and experience may be considered. 15+ years of progressive Quality Assurance and Regulatory Affairs experience within the medical device industry. 10+ years of experience of people management experience, including driving results through others, leading teams or projects, and providing training Demonstrated success leading FDA inspections and BSI ISO 13485 surveillance and recertification audits. Significant experience with FDA 510(k) submissions, Health Canada licensing activities, and regulatory agency interactions. Extensive knowledge of FDA regulations, FDA Quality System Regulations (21 CFR Part 820), ISO 13485 requirements, and Health Canada Medical Device Regulations. Strong experience with complaint handling, CAPA, post-market surveillance, Medical Device Reporting (MDR), recalls, field actions, supplier quality, and risk management. Experience supporting commercial medical device organizations with sales, marketing, service, customer support, and product lifecycle responsibilities. Experience collaborating with global development, quality, and regulatory partners within a multinational organization. Experience supporting software-enabled and connected medical device products preferred.
